Key Considerations

Key Considerations

When selecting a Customer Data Integration (CDI) vendor, it's crucial to consider several key factors to ensure the solution aligns with your business needs. The right vendor can streamline data management, enhance customer insights, and drive better decision-making.

First, evaluate the vendor's ability to integrate with your existing systems. Seamless integration is vital to avoid disruptions and ensure a smooth flow of data. Look for vendors like ApiX-Drive, which offer robust integration capabilities with various platforms, making the setup process straightforward and efficient.

  • Scalability: Ensure the solution can grow with your business.
  • Data Security: Verify that the vendor adheres to strict security protocols.
  • Customization: The ability to tailor the solution to your specific needs.
  • Support and Training: Availability of comprehensive support and training resources.

Finally, consider the vendor's track record and customer reviews. A reliable CDI vendor should have a proven history of successful implementations and satisfied clients. By thoroughly assessing these factors, you can select a vendor that will effectively support your data integration needs and contribute to your business's long-term success.

FAQ

What is Customer Data Integration (CDI)?

Customer Data Integration (CDI) is the process of combining customer information from different sources to provide a unified, accurate, and comprehensive view of the customer. This helps businesses improve customer service, marketing efforts, and decision-making by having consistent and reliable data.

Why is CDI important for businesses?

CDI is crucial because it ensures that all customer data is accurate, up-to-date, and consistent across different systems. This leads to better customer experiences, more effective marketing campaigns, and improved business insights. It also helps in reducing data redundancy and errors.

How can businesses implement CDI effectively?

Businesses can implement CDI effectively by using integration platforms that allow for seamless data synchronization between different systems. These platforms can automate data flows, reducing manual work and errors. They also offer tools for data cleaning, transformation, and validation to ensure data quality.

What challenges might businesses face with CDI?

Common challenges include data quality issues, such as duplicates and inaccuracies, integration complexities between different systems, and maintaining data privacy and security. Businesses need to have robust data governance policies and use reliable integration tools to address these challenges.

Can small businesses benefit from CDI?

Yes, small businesses can greatly benefit from CDI as it helps them manage customer data more efficiently, leading to better customer insights and personalized experiences. Even with limited resources, small businesses can use affordable integration tools to automate data processes and improve overall data management.
